140 # HACK: we need to override SHLIB_LC from gcc/config/t-slibgcc-elf-ver or
141 # gcc/config/t-libunwind so -lc is removed from the link for
142 # libgcc_s.so, as we do not have a target -lc yet.
143 # This is not as ugly as it appears to be ;-) All symbols get resolved
144 # during the glibc build, and we provide a proper libgcc_s.so for the
145 # cross toolchain during the final gcc build.
147 # As we cannot modify the source tree, nor override SHLIB_LC itself
148 # during configure or make, we have to edit the resultant
149 # gcc/libgcc.mk itself to remove -lc from the link.
150 # This causes us to have to jump through some hoops...
152 # To produce libgcc.mk to edit we firstly require libiberty.a,
153 # so we configure then build it.
154 # Next we have to configure gcc, create libgcc.mk then edit it...
155 # So much easier if we just edit the source tree, but hey...
156 if [ ! -f "${CT_SRC_DIR}/${CT_CC_FILE}/gcc/BASE-VER" ]; then
157 make configure-libiberty
158 make -C libiberty libiberty.a
160 make configure-libcpp
164 make configure-libcpp
165 make configure-build-libiberty
167 make all-build-libiberty
168 fi 2>&1 |CT_DoLog ALL
169 # HACK: gcc-4.2 uses libdecnumber to build libgcc.mk, so build it here.
170 if [ -d "${CT_SRC_DIR}/${CT_CC_FILE}/libdecnumber" ]; then
171 make configure-libdecnumber
172 make -C libdecnumber libdecnumber.a
173 fi 2>&1 |CT_DoLog ALL
174 make -C gcc libgcc.mk 2>&1 |CT_DoLog ALL
175 sed -r -i -e 's@-lc@@g' gcc/libgcc.mk
